Ten laptops made this list out of a much larger pool, and the ranking was rebuilt once around a single realisation: the graphics tier printed on the box tells you less than the power the chassis grants that chip. Two machines with the same silicon can sit a tier apart in practice. Everything below follows from measuring the second thing rather than reading the first.
Sustained graphics power carries the heaviest weighting at roughly a third of the score, with panel and cooling taking about a fifth each and the remainder split across processor, fitted memory and portability. No manufacturer had any input into the order.
Start with total graphics power, not the model name. Every laptop maker chooses how much power to grant its graphics chip, and that choice varies enormously between a thin chassis and a thick one. This is why an RTX 5070 in a well-cooled 16-inch body can outrun an RTX 5070 Ti in something slimmer. If a listing does not state the figure, treat the chassis thickness and the fan count as your proxy.
Then check whether a MUX switch is fitted. Routing the display directly to the graphics chip instead of through the integrated one is worth more frames than a tier upgrade in some titles, and it costs nothing. NVIDIA G-SYNC support matters for the same reason: matching frame delivery to the panel removes tearing without capping performance.
Memory deserves more attention than it gets. Sixteen gigabytes is workable today and will feel tight inside three years, so a machine shipping thirty-two is buying you time. Storage is the same story in miniature. Modern titles are large, and a 512GB drive holds surprisingly few of them.
Panels are where budget tiers save money quietly. Refresh rate gets advertised; colour coverage and brightness do not. If the laptop will double as a work machine, a 2560x1600 panel is worth the step up. If it drives an external monitor, buy the cheapest acceptable screen and put the money into silicon.
Entry-level means a current graphics chip with compromises elsewhere. Mid-range buys you a matched panel and fitted memory. Premium buys engineering, thin chassis and build quality rather than raw frames. Prosumer territory adds upgradeable bays and cooling sized past what the chip needs.

Twelve gigabytes is the comfortable floor now. Texture budgets in current titles have grown faster than graphics chips have, and running out of video memory produces stutter that no amount of processor headroom fixes. An RTX 5070 with twelve gigabytes will age better than a nominally faster chip with less. If you play at 1440p or drive a 4K monitor, treat that figure as a minimum rather than a target.

Not any more, though it depends on your habits. Contrast and response time are better than any backlit panel can reach, and modern pixel-shifting mitigations have made burn-in a much smaller risk than it was. Static interface elements left on screen for eight hours a day are still the thing to avoid. Gaming and video are exactly what these panels are good at.
Plan on four years of comfortable use. The graphics chip usually stays playable longer than people expect; what forces the upgrade is memory, storage and a battery that has lost most of its capacity. Machines with fitted thirty-two gigabytes and open bays, like the Alienware, stretch further. Sealed budget models with half-size drives tend to frustrate around year three.
For gaming alone, yes, today. Add a browser with thirty tabs, a chat client and streaming software and sixteen starts to bind. The practical answer is that sixteen is fine if you buy a machine whose memory you can add to later, and worth stepping past if the memory is soldered. Thirty-two is the amount I would want on anything sealed.
